North East Derbyshire District Council is seeking a Lifeguard to supervise swimming pools, changing rooms, sports halls, and squash courts. Responsibilities include assisting swimmers, managing equipment, and promoting activities at the centre.
The ideal candidate should have an RLSS UK National Pool Lifeguard Award and be capable of lifting weights. The role requires availability during evenings and weekends, with the opportunity for those available Monday to Friday.
Benefits include a competitive salary, Local Government Pension Scheme, and generous annual leave.
